  • Parse Labels from newick tree

    Hey there,

    I am searching for script which extract the node labels from a given newick String. Is there any tool available at the internet, or maybe someone of you guys can help me...

    There are several options available - which programing language are you happiest with? If Python, then Biopython includes a Newick parser.

    Also it would help if you could clarify exactly what you want to get out - just a list of the node labels, throwing away the tree structure?

      I just want to have the labels. Tree structure can be thrown away... Python is fine...

        If there are internal node labels, do you want the terminal (leaf) names only?

        e.g. Using Biopython

        Code:
        from Bio import Phylo
        tree = Phylo.read("int_node_labels.nwk", "newick")
        for leaf in tree.get_terminals(): print leaf.name

          Internal as well would be great...

            Internal as well would be great...
            For just the internal nodes,
            Code:
            from Bio import Phylo
            tree = Phylo.read("int_node_labels.nwk", "newick")
            for node in tree.get_nonterminals(): print node.name
            For everything try:
            Code:
            from Bio import Phylo
            tree = Phylo.read("int_node_labels.nwk", "newick")
            for node in tree.find_clades():
                #Don't print anything if there is no name
                if node.name:
                    print node.name
